Ingredients List
- 1 package of puff pastry (thawed) – This flaky pastry is the star of the show, creating that delightful crunch on the outside.
- 8 oz cream cheese (softened) – You’ll want it nice and creamy for that smooth filling that melts in your mouth.
- 1/4 cup sugar – Just a touch of sweetness to balance out the creaminess of the cheese.
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ract – This adds a lovely aromatic flavor that enhances the overall taste.
- 1 egg (beaten) – This is for your filling, giving it a rich texture and helping everything hold together.
- 1 tablespoon flour – A little bit of flour helps stabilize the cheese mixture, preventing any runny situations.
- 1 egg wash (1 egg beaten with 1 tablespoon water) – This is your secret weapon for achieving that gorgeous golden finish on top!

Step-by-Step Instructions
- First things first, go ahead and pre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). This ensures your danishes bake up perfectly golden and flaky.
- Next, roll out the puff pastry on a lightly floured surface. You want it to be nice and even, about 1/8 inch thick. If it’s a bit sticky, don’t hesitate to sprinkle on a little more flour.
- Now, cut the rolled pastry into squares—about 4 inches each side works great. This is where the magic starts to happen!
- In a mixing bowl, combine the softened cream cheese, sugar, vanilla extract, flour, and that beaten egg. Mix until it’s smooth and creamy, like a dream come true.
- Place a generous spoonful of the cheese mixture right in the center of each pastry square. Don’t skimp on this part; it’s where all the flavor lives!
- Time to fold! Gently bring the corners of the pastry over the filling to create little pockets. Pinch them closed to seal in that delicious goodness.
- Brush the tops with your egg wash—this gives them that beautiful, shiny finish. It’s the perfect final touch!
- Pop them in the oven and bake for 20-25 minutes, or until they’re gloriously golden brown. Your kitchen will smell incredible, and you’ll be counting down the minutes!
- Once they’re done, let them cool for just a few minutes before digging in. Patience is key, but I know it’s hard!

Tips for Success

To make sure your breakfast cheese danishes turn out perfectly, here are a few handy tips! First, keep your puff pastry cold until you’re ready to use it; this helps maintain its flaky texture. When rolling it out, don’t overwork the dough—just enough to get it even is perfect. If you want a bit of extra flavor, try adding a splash of lemon zest to the cream cheese mixture. And remember, every oven is different, so keep an eye on your danishes as they bake. When they’re golden brown, they’re ready to shine on your breakfast table!
Variations
Let’s get creative with your breakfast cheese danish! You can mix it up by adding different fillings—try incorporating fruit preserves, like raspberry or apricot, for a burst of sweetness. For a fun twist, add chocolate chips or even a sprinkle of cinnamon to the cream cheese mixture. Feeling adventurous? Top your danishes with a drizzle of icing or fresh berries after baking. The possibilities are endless, and I just know you’ll find your favorite combo!
Storage & Reheating Instructions
If you happen to have any leftovers (which is rare, let’s be honest!), you can store your breakfast cheese danishes in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. When you’re ready to enjoy them again, simply pre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and pop the danishes in for about 10 minutes to warm them through. This way, they’ll regain that lovely flakiness and creamy center that makes them so irresistible. Trust me, it’s well worth the wait!

FAQ Section
Can I use homemade puff pastry instead of store-bought? Absolutely! If you’re feeling ambitious and want to make your own puff pastry, go for it! Just make sure it’s rolled out to the same thickness for best results.
Can I make these danishes ahead of time? Yes! You can prepare the cheese filling and cut the pastry squares in advance. Just assemble and bake them when you’re ready for a fresh breakfast treat.
What can I use instead of cream cheese? If you want a lighter option, you can use ricotta cheese or mascarpone. They’ll give a different flavor but still taste amazing!
How do I know when the danishes are done baking? Keep an eye on them; they should be golden brown and puffed up nicely. If they look beautiful, they’re probably ready!
Can I freeze the breakfast cheese danish? Definitely! Just freeze the baked danishes in an airtight container. When you’re ready to eat, thaw and reheat them in the oven for that fresh-baked taste!
